| Abstract: | Inductive learning techniques have shown inspiring success in reducing the effort for knowledge acquisition in the development of knowledge-based scheduling systems. This study proposes a neural network-based approach to identify the essential attributes for knowledge-based scheduling systems. Through the case study conducted, the proposed identification procedure is capable of selecting the essential attributes out of a given set of candidate attributes. |
